server, ui: only offer a working directory when a tool reads it (#26762)

The working directory chip showed up as soon as the server exposed any
builtin tool, so a server started with just get_datetime, or a user who
turned every filesystem tool off in the settings, still got a control
that nothing would read.

Tools now declare whether they resolve their paths and run against the
working directory, next to the write permission they already publish in
the /tools listing. The WebUI shows the chip and enables the /cwd
command only when at least one such tool is both served and left
enabled.
